One bricklayer can build a wall in 6 hours. Another bricklayer could build the same wall in 4 hours. If they work together, how
Natasha2012 [34]

Answer:

they work together, it will take 2.4 hours to build the wall.

Step-by-step explanation:

One bricklayer can build a wall in 6 hours.

One hour work = \frac{1}{6}

Another bricklayer can build the same wall in 4 hours.

One hour work = \frac{1}{4}

They can together, how long will take them to build the wall.

Let's take "t" the time taken to build the wall.

The sum of their work rate = 1 (To build the wall)

\frac{t}{6} + \frac{t}{4} = 1

Now we have to solve this equation. Take LCD of 6 and 4.

The LCD (least common divisor) of 6 and 4 is 12.

\frac{2t + 3t}{12} = 1

5t = 12*1

5t = 12

Dividing both sides by 5, we get

t = \frac{12}{5}

t = 2.4 hours.

So, they work together, it will take 2.4 hours to build the wall.

The sum of two squares of two consecutive natural numbers is 41.Find the numbers​
Arada [10]
<h3><u>AnswEr</u><u> </u><u>:</u></h3>

The 2 unknown numbers are 4 and 5 .

<h3><u>Expla</u><u>nation</u><u> </u><u>:</u></h3>

Let the numbers be x and x + 1.

From the given information,

\dashrightarrow\sf \ \ \ x^2 + (x + 1)^2 = 41 \\  \\  \\

\dashrightarrow\sf \ \ \ 2 {x}^{2}  + 2x + 1 = 41 \\  \\  \\

\dashrightarrow\sf \ \ \ 2 {x}^{2}  + 2x + 1 - 41=0 \\  \\  \\

\dashrightarrow\sf \ \ \  {x}^{2}  + x - 20 = 0 \\  \\  \\

\dashrightarrow\sf \ \ \ (x + 5)(x - 4)=0 \\  \\  \\

\dashrightarrow\sf \ \ \ { \underline{ \boxed{ \bf{ \red{x =  - 5,4}}}}} \ \bigstar \\  \\

But, as we know -5 is not a natural number,

Hence, x = 4 .

<u>So the 2 unknown numbers are</u><u> </u><u>:</u>

  • x = 4 [1st number]

  • x + 1 = 4 + 1 = 5 [2nd number]

Find the LCM of 40a2b and 48ab4.​
salantis [7]

Answer:

Step-by-step explanation:

40a²b =  2* 2 * 2 * 5 * a² * b      =  2³ * 5 * a² * b

48ab⁴ = 2 * 2 * 2 * 2 * 3 * a *b⁴  = 2⁴ *  3 * a * b⁴

LCM = 2⁴ * 3 * 5 * a² * b⁴

       = 16 * 3 * 5 * a² * b⁴

       = 240a²b⁴
